Tasting Notes – San Cebrin Clarete

This rosé wine from Bodegas San Cebrin is one of my favourite wines. It’s not just a summer wine, you can drink it any time of the year. My fridge never lacks a bottle 🤣. This wine is best served chilled, between 8 and 10ºc.
